J.A. Varela is a scholar working on Materials Chemistry, Electrical and Electronic Engineering and Electronic, Optical and Magnetic Materials. According to data from OpenAlex, J.A. Varela has authored 37 papers receiving a total of 1.1k indexed citations (citations by other indexed papers that have themselves been cited), including 27 papers in Materials Chemistry, 21 papers in Electrical and Electronic Engineering and 9 papers in Electronic, Optical and Magnetic Materials. Recurrent topics in J.A. Varela's work include Ferroelectric and Piezoelectric Materials (19 papers), Microwave Dielectric Ceramics Synthesis (16 papers) and Luminescence Properties of Advanced Materials (7 papers). J.A. Varela is often cited by papers focused on Ferroelectric and Piezoelectric Materials (19 papers), Microwave Dielectric Ceramics Synthesis (16 papers) and Luminescence Properties of Advanced Materials (7 papers). J.A. Varela collaborates with scholars based in Brazil, Spain and United States. J.A. Varela's co-authors include E. Longo, L.S. Cavalcante, P.S. Pizani, A.Z. Simões, J.C. Sczancoski, Miryam R. Joya, Juán Andrés, C.R. Foschini, M.A. Zaghete and Máximo Siu Li and has published in prestigious journals such as Applied Physics Letters, Journal of Applied Physics and Chemical Engineering Journal.
